India:Tropical Cyclone:2019/05/03

Duration2019/05/03 Tropical Cyclone FANI made landfall in Odisha State, India on the morning of 3 May 2019, with maximum sustained winds up to 240 km/h. Over 1 million people have been evacuated from coastal communities in Odisha and Andhra Pradesh and 4,852 shelters have been set up.

  • ECHO 2019/05/06
    As of 6 May 2019 at 8.00 UTC, at least 33 people have been reported dead in India following the passage of Tropical Cyclone FANI. Odisha State has been the most heavily affected, with electricity and infrastructure damaged.
  • ECHO 2019/05/03
    Over the next 24 hours, heavy to very heavy rainfall, strong wind and storm surge are forecast over coastal and adjoining districts of Odisha and West Bengal and eastern Bangladesh.
